Joey Mazzarino

Joseph Mazzarino (born June 4, 1968) is an American puppeteer, actor, writer and director. He is best known for his roles on Sesame Street as Murray Monster, Stinky the Stinkweed and other Muppets. Mazzarino was also the head writer for the show in 1992.[1]

Career

Former Muppet performer Camille Bonora influenced Mazzarino when she taught an improvisation class at his university, and eventually introduced him to Jim Henson. Mazzarino later became the head writer for Sesame Street and also worked on The Adventures of Elmo in Grouchland, Muppets From Space, and Kermit's Swamp Years.[2]

When Mazzarino auditioned for Sesame Street, he wrote a sketch called "Colambo" and soon found himself cast in the title role. Since then, he had been a prominent member of the Sesame Street cast where he performed Horatio the Elephant, Murray Monster, Papa Bear, Stinky the Stinkweed, and various characters until 2015, when he resigned.

Personal life

Mazzarino is married to actress Kerry Butler.[3] They have two adoptive daughters, one named Segi for whom he wrote the Sesame Street song "I Love My Hair." The Muppet who sang the song was also named Segi.
